How does Julia handle latency vs throughput tradeoffs?

Updated May 16, 2026

Short answer

Julia prioritizes throughput via JIT optimization but requires careful tuning to avoid latency spikes.

Deep explanation

Julia excels in throughput-heavy workloads due to aggressive specialization and LLVM optimizations. However, latency can be impacted by JIT compilation, garbage collection, and dispatch overhead. Engineers balance this by precompiling workloads, minimizing allocations, and using static dispatch in critical paths.
